William Charles Electric, a MasTec company, is seeking a Senior Project Manager to support assigned renewables and power delivery projects. The Senior Project Manager is a leadership position and will manage the financial and business aspects of William Charles Electric. This position provides leadership and responsibility for both technical and administrative positions that will involve short and long term planning. Responsible for establishing and managing the business units' goals and objectives. The Senior Project Manager will have the lead role to interface with assigned Construction Project Leaders and for all aspects of the projects from initial budgeting, planning and development. Utilization of the Construction Department policies and procedures and Project Controls requirements to plan, organize, monitor, control and report status progress. The Senior Project Manager is directly responsible for the financial P&L within the department's operations for assigned projects. Travel & Project Assignment: You can live in any city or state in the continental United States. This is a traveling position encompassing work sites primarily in the Midwest, but may include Eastern and Western states. Must be capable of up to 75% travel (e.g. 3 weeks per month) by automobile (as driver and passenger), commercial airlines, rental vehicles and public transportation and be able to lodge in public facilities. Travel will be necessary to conduct the duties of this job, and the employee must have the ability to drive and have proper licensing. A Corporate credit card for travel expenses will be issued to you. Travel for this position will be expensed thru the company expense system. You will be responsible for maintaining expense records and receipts, and completing the monthly the monthly transactions in Concur.
